Detailed Comparison

MetricEnergy plant operativesVehicle body builders and repairersDifference
Median Annual£46,597£35,336+£11,261
Mean Annual£52,102£36,531+£15,571
Monthly£3,883£2,945+£938
Weekly£896£680+£216
Hourly£22.40£16.99+£5.41
